How much peanut butter did you use Kristi? I have some silicone candy molds and I've been using a wafer of chocolate, a dab of peanut butter and topped with another chocolate then bake at 250 for 10 minutes. But I'm still experimenting with how much PB. They're good like Reeses. I keep adding more. I haven't tried it with white chocolate yet though.
